Dushyant Chautala among 5 to file nominations in Haryana

Five candidates including INLD's Dushyant Chautala today filed their nomination papers in Haryana for the Lok Sabha polls to be held on all the ten seats in the state on April 10.
The procedure for filing nominations started on March 15.
"Among those who filed their papers included Dushyant, the son of Ajay Singh Chautala, who filed nomination for the Hisar Lok Sabha constituency," Shrikant Walgad, Chief Electoral Officer Haryana, said.
26-year-old Dushyant is the fourth generation member of the family of former deputy prime minister Devi Lal.
Virender Verma, BSP candidate, filed his papers for the Karnal Lok Sabha seat.
From the Kurukshetra constituency, Balbir Singh Saini, INLD candidate, and Chunni Manoj Kumar, an Independent, filed their nominations.
Walgad said that two candidates had already filed their nominations for the Faridabad constituency on March 15. They included Deepak Gaur, candidate of the Aarakshan Virodhi Morcha Party, and Sanjay Maurya, an Independent candidate.
The last day for filing nominations is March 22.
